Full Job Description
Job Description

We are currently seeking an Assistant Electrical Discipline Manager for our Healthcare Electrical Team in our Raleigh, NC office!

 

In this pivotal role, you will be responsible for ensuring the successful execution of electrical projects as outlined in proposals, while effectively managing and mentoring your staff to achieve outstanding results. You will work closely with Project and Client Managers to provide essential engineering resources and assemble a high-performing design team that meets client expectations and budgetary goals. Your expertise will also extend to direct MEP sales and supporting multidisciplinary project efforts. Familiarity with NFPA 99, NEC 517, and FGI will be advantageous. You will report directly to Dewberry’s Electrical Discipline Manager.

 

Join our dynamic team of approximately 200 design professionals in making a significant impact in the field of engineering. 

 

 

 

Responsibilities

Assistant Electrical Discipline Manager will assist the Healthcare Electrical Discipline Manager in leading their department (~8 staff) to effectively and successfully complete projects, including:

  • Growing, mentoring, and developing department staff to allow each person to achieve their maximum potential.
  • Minimum annual evaluations for each direct report.
  • Technical and Quality oversight of all project work for department.
  • Establishing/improving department standards.
  • Adherence to project design schedules.
  • Notification to Project/Client Managers if established project design schedule cannot be met.
  • Adherence to department project budget. Review and provide updates on project budgets at milestone dates. Reviewing discipline budgets weekly.
  • Attention to project scope during the design process to identify potential additional services.
  • Identify department staff performing design of the project, along with a senior staff and EOR as required.
  • Provide general updates of projects (status in the process, tasks to complete, percentage complete currently, etc.)
  • Identify milestone dates when each discipline should provide information, at each phase, to allow sufficient time to good design coordination.
  • Provide 'on-the-spot' advice and decisions, technical and cost estimates.
  • Coordination with all disciplines involved, including outside consultants.
  • Work schedule for discipline showing:
  • Project assignments and priorities
  • Delivery due dates for group project commitment’s
  • Workload/Capacity
    • Organizing staff in a way to allow career advancement, professional development, quality client service, and operational efficiencies to meet business and project financial goals.
    • Taking a very active role in recruitment of staff in discipline area including networking, recruitment, interviewing and “deal closing”.
    • The Assistant Discipline Manager’s goal is to, when ready, become a Discipline Manager, leading their own department.
    Required Skills & Required Experience

     

      • Licensed Professional Engineer (P.E.) or ability to obtain licensure through reciprocity (example through Comity) within the State in which the position is posted within six (6) months.
      • 8+yrs experience.
      • Familiar with AIA and state construction contracts
      • Self-motivated with highly developed verbal, written, and interpersonal skills
      • Experience in staff management/department management
      • Experience in the design of various MEP systems, and an understanding of document preparation utilizing both CADD and BIM/Revit platforms
      • Well organized, takes good notes
      • Good conceptual understanding of plumbing, mechanical and electrical systems with general knowledge of system operation, space requirements, and cost.

    About Dewberry

    Dewberry is a professional services firm specializing in engineering, architecture, environmental sciences, and planning services. The company was founded in 1956 and is headquartered in Fairfax, Virginia. Dewberry has over 50 locations throughout the United States and employs over 2,000 professionals. The company provides services to a variety of industries, including transportation, water, energy, and government. Dewberry has been recognized for its work on a number of high-profile projects, including the World Trade Center Memorial in New York City and the National Museum of African American History and Culture in Washington, D.C.
